WebJun 7, 2024 · Triple Bottom Line (also known as TBL or 3BL) is a transformational framework for businesses to achieve sustainability and financial success. The Triple Bottom Line in business aids in measuring, benchmarking, setting goals, continually improving, and adopting sustainable systems. It also addresses social and environmental concerns.
